## Changelog — Font vendoring defaults changed

As of this release, the Bracken UI build no longer fetches third-party fonts at build time. All typefaces used by the Lanternwell suite are now vendored into the repo under a dedicated assets directory, and the fetch step is skipped by default. If you're onboarding, nothing to install — the fonts travel with the checkout. The build flags controlling this behavior are listed below.

settings of hadup-yafog:
LAMAEL_PIN=3761
LAMAEL_TENANT=istmir
LAMAEL_METRICS_HOST=metrics.lamael.plorvasys.test
LAMAEL_SEAL=seal_8ea68500
LAMAEL_STANDBY_TEAM=fraok

## Runbook: Gaugepile Sidecar — Release Checklist

Heads up: the sidecar ships with every app pod, so a bad config fans out fast. Before cutting a release, confirm the flush interval hasn't drifted from what the Tallyhouse aggregator expects, or you'll see sawtooth gaps in dashboards. Rollbacks are cheap — just repin the image tag. Canary one node pool first, watch for ten minutes, then proceed. The values to verify against are these.

config for bagep-yafof:
quenath:
  pin: 8584
  metrics_host: metrics.quenath.tolvaqsys.internal
  tenant: pelath
  seal: seal_ed102645

Subject: Waveform preview cut-over — done

The audio waveform preview on Plinkett is now fully on the new renderer. Old path is disabled, not deleted; removal PR comes next week. Latency dropped roughly 40% and the jagged-peaks artifact is gone. One known issue: previews over ten minutes clip the tail, fix pending. Rollback is a single flag flip if anything surfaces. For review, the renderer is currently running with the following configuration.

config for bawig-fadup:
[zorix]
host = zorix.lumicworks.corp
user = zorix_svc
database = zorix_prod